Partilhar via


Adicionar elemento appSettings (Geral Configurações Schema)

Adiciona uma configuração de aplicativo personalizado como um par nome/valor à coleção de configurações do aplicativo.

<add
   key="String name"
   value="String value"
/>

Atributos e elementos

As seções a seguir descrevem atributos, elementos filho, e elementos pai.

Atributos

Atributo

Descrição

key

Obrigatório String atributo.

Especifica o nome da configuração do aplicativo. Esse atributo é a chave da coleção.

value

Obrigatório String atributo.

Especifica o valor da configuração do aplicativo.

Atributos herdados

Atributos opcionais.

Atributos que são herdados por todos os elementos de seção. Para obter mais informações, consulte Geral Atributos Herdados por elementos de seção.

Elementos filho

Nenhum.

Elementos pai

Elemento

Descrição

configuration

Especifica o elemento raiz necessários em cada arquivo de configuração que é usado pelo common language runtime e a.Aplicativos do NET Framework.

system.web

Especifica o elemento raiz para o ASP.Definições de configuração de rede em uma configuração de arquivo e contém elementos de configuração para configurar aplicativos ASP.NET e controlar como os aplicativos se comportam.

appSettings

Contém configurações de aplicativo personalizado, como, por exemplo, caminhos de arquivo, URLs de serviço XML da Web ou qualquer informação que é armazenada no arquivo. ini para um aplicativo.

Comentários

O add elemento adiciona uma configuração de aplicativo personalizado como um par nome/valor à coleção de configurações de aplicativo herdado na appSettings elemento.

Observação importanteImportante

As chaves devem ser exclusivas.Se você adicionar várias entradas com a mesma chave somente a última entrada é mantida.

O appSettings elemento armazena informações de configuração de aplicativo personalizado, como caminhos de arquivo, URLs de serviço XML da Web ou qualquer informação que está armazenada no arquivo. ini para um aplicativo. Os pares chave/valor que são especificados no appSettings elemento pode ser acessado no código usando o ConfigurationSettings classe. O exemplo mostra como acessar o appSettings programaticamente.

Configuração padrão

O seguinte padrão appSettings elemento é configurado no arquivo Machine. config na.NET Framework versões 1.0 e 1.1.

<appSettings>
        <add key="XML File Name" value="myXmlFileName.xml" /> 
    </appSettings>

Exemplo

Os arquivos de configuração são especificados em um file atributo deve ter appSettings em vez de configuração como o nó raiz. O código a seguir está correto para um arquivo de configuração é especificado na file atributo.

<?xml version="1.0" encoding="utf-8" ?>
<appSettings>
<add key="Application1" value="MyApplication1" />
<add key="Setting1" value="MySetting" />
</appSettings>

O exemplo de código a seguir mostra como definir uma configuração de aplicativo personalizado em um arquivo de configuração.

<configuration>
    <appSettings>
        <add key="Application Name" value="MyApplication" />
    </appSettings>
</configuration>

Informações do elemento

Manipulador de seção de configuração

AppSettingsSection

Membro de configuração

Add

Locais configuráveis

Machine.config

Web. config de nível de raiz

Web. config de nível de aplicativo

Virtual ou física directory–level Web. config

Requisitos

De da (IIS) versão 5.0, 5.1 ou 6.0

A.NET Framework versão 1.0, 1.1 ou 2.0

Microsoft Visual Studio 2003 ou 2005 de Visual Studio

Consulte também

Referência

appSettings Element (Geral Configurações Schema)

configuração Element (Geral Configurações Schema)

Desmarque elemento appSettings (Geral Configurações Schema)

remover o elemento appSettings (Geral Configurações Schema)

Conceitos

Protegendo a configuração do ASP.NET

Cenários de configuração ASP.NET

Outros recursos

General Configuration Settings (ASP.NET)

ASP.NET Configuration Settings

Arquivos de configuração ASP.NET